Understanding the Basics of Barcodes
Before diving into the how-to’s, let’s first understand what barcodes are. Essentially, a barcode is a method of representing data in a visual, machine-readable form. They’re those black stripes or squares you see on products at the store. When scanned, they reveal specific information about the product.
Barcodes come in various formats, such as UPC, EAN, and QR codes. Each serves its own purpose, whether for scanning retail products or embedding links. Understanding these basics will provide a better grasp of how to utilize them with Telegram links effectively.

Linking Telegram with Your Barcode Generator
Once your barcode generator is ready, the next move is integrating it with Telegram. This step is crucial. Imagine the generator as an artist and Telegram as its canvas. The art cannot appear if the two don’t connect seamlessly.
To achieve this, you’ll need to configure a Telegram bot. This bot acts as a bridge, fetching links from your conversations and passing them to the barcode generator. Setting up this bot may sound daunting, but with the right guidance, it becomes straightforward. Follow your platform’s instructions carefully to ensure smooth interaction between Telegram and your barcode tool.

Frequently Asked Questions
1. Can I create barcodes for any type of link?
Absolutely! Barcodes can be created for any kind of hyperlink, whether it’s a website, document, video, or even a specific social media page.
2. Do I need any special equipment to scan barcodes?
No special equipment is necessary. Most smartphones come equipped with barcode-scanning capabilities in their camera apps, making it easy to scan and access links.
3. Is this service free to use?
Many platforms offer free basic services for generating barcodes, but advanced features or higher usage limits might require a paid subscription. Always check the terms of service of your chosen tool.
4. Will the barcodes I create from Telegram links expire?
Generally, barcodes do not have an expiration date. However, if the original link becomes inactive or is deleted, the barcode will no longer function.
